Introduction
Wong Wing Suet developed her passion in Saori weaving since first practicing the art in 2007, where she likes using bright colours to express her feelings and realize her imagination. Her art works are widely received in society, not only were some of them showing great diversity available for sale in the market while some were displayed in “The Joy of Weaving - SAORI Hand-weaving Project Exhibition” at Hong Kong Central Library, where she taught the exhibition visitors some basic weaving techniques and share the art with others. One of the art pieces, “Space Age” was also shortlisted in “Cross All Borders: Hong Kong Festival Showcasing New Visual Artists with Disabilities 2010”.
Wing Suet hopes to obtain an opportunity to visit Japan and exchange with its local artists, as well as to gain a deeper understanding of its culture of Saori weaving.
